Output 31f540176a715cb90bf35324a2c3d99747950d0d65b2d352779e307dcf48f69b:0

value
4397905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d14b21405dbd6e21bf69aac28ddfac21e13ebae OP_EQUAL
address
32tBVzd5GYAJSCgtKdUEkh2TaXpsotw5oQ
transaction
31f540176a715cb90bf35324a2c3d99747950d0d65b2d352779e307dcf48f69b
spent
true